Evaluating Your Current Environmental Impact

What methods allow a business to accurately assess its environmental impact? To accurately measure their present ecological footprint, companies should conduct a comprehensive assessment of their activities. This involves examining energy utilization, waste production, water utilization, and greenhouse gases emitted across every procedure. Using tools including life cycle assessments (LCAs) may deliver knowledge about the environmental impacts of products from creation to end-of-life.

Furthermore, businesses should participate in data collection and monitoring practices to assess their resource utilization and waste outputs. Partnering with environmental consultants can strengthen this assessment, as they bring expertise in identifying areas for improvement. Moreover, conducting employee surveys can uncover insights into operational practices that may lead to environmental degradation. By methodically evaluating these aspects, businesses can establish a clear baseline of their environmental impact, facilitating informed decision-making in sustainability efforts.

What Are the Typical Costs of Hiring an Environmental Consultant?

Hiring an environmental consultant typically costs between $100 to $300 per hour, contingent upon factors such as specialization, project complexity, and location. Some consultants may also offer fixed rates for certain services or projects.

Which Qualifications Should I Look for in an Environmental Consultant?

When choosing an environmental consultant, one should prioritize certifications such as ISO 14001, LEED accreditation, and Certified Environmental Professional (CEP). These credentials demonstrate expertise in environmental management, sustainability practices, and regulatory compliance, ensuring reliable guidance.
